Shipping container and method of folding a shipping container
11560251 · 2023-01-24 · ·

A foldable container blank includes at four side walls, a top panel foldably connected to one of the side walls, a bottom panel foldably connected to one of the side walls, and at least one internal support structure that is connected to one of the side walls. Each internal support structure includes a first portion that is in adjacent relation with the top panel when the container is in a closed condition, and a second portion that is in adjacent relation with the first portion when the container is in a closed condition. In some embodiments, the foldable container blank is integrally formed. A method of forming the foldable container blank and a method of folding a container blank are also provided.

PACKING MATERIAL
20230219744 · 2023-07-13 ·

Provided is a packing material that makes it possible to omit an exclusive part for installing a robot on a stand, and to reduce the number of parts of the robot. The packing material for packing the robot has a first support member that supports the robot in a state in which a base of the robot is exposed, and the first support member is provided with grip portions which are held by a worker to lift the robot together with the first support member.

Furniture corner protector
11596228 · 2023-03-07 · ·

Corner protectors, including corner protectors for furniture corners, are shown and described. Corner protectors may include, in some examples, a body, a first end including a shoulder, a second end including a cutout, a first side, and a second side. A cutout may include an attachment projection and an attachment receptor. Corner protector sheets may stack for convenient storage, with individual corner protectors removable from the corner protector sheet and each taking on an expanded form to fit around a furniture corner.

CUSHIONING MATERIAL, PACKING MATERIAL, AND PACKED GOODS
20230141442 · 2023-05-11 ·

Provided is a cushioning material for being put into a packing box configured for encasement of electronic equipment. The cushioning material absorbs external stress applied to the electronic equipment encased in the packing box. The cushioning material includes: a first holder including a first plate configured to face the electronic equipment when the cushioning material and the electronic equipment are encased in the packing box, and a second plate configured to face an inner wall surface of the packing box when the cushioning material and the electronic equipment are encased in the packing box; and a first cushioning block provided between the first plate and the second plate.

Corner bumper
11253037 · 2022-02-22 · ·

A corner bumper is adapted to be mounted to a corner of a substantially hard-sided carryable case, transport container, or the like, to act as a shock absorber for protecting the case and its contents from exterior impact. The bumper comprises intersecting wall portions to substantially cover the adjacent planes of a corner. The bumper includes feet elements to act as a base upon which the case can stand and space the base a distance from the underlying support surface.

Packaging system and method
09776767 · 2017-10-03 · ·

A packaging combination is disclosed that includes a box and at least first and second planar objects in the box. At least first and second shock absorbing clips are attached to the planar objects in the box. At least one of the first clips is fastened to the first planar object and the clip is positioned between one wall of the box and the second planar object. At least one of the second clips is fastened to both planar objects and is positioned between opposite walls of the box.

Packaging material

A packaging material includes: an outer box that accommodates an article to be packaged; and a cushioning material including: a sealed bag body with gas confined inside; a partition that divides an inside of the bag body into a first chamber and a second chamber each in an equal volume; and a ventilation passage communicating the first and second chambers, the cushioning material being disposed in a gap between an outer surface of the article and an inner wall of the outer box.

CASE INSERT TO SECURE WOODWIND REEDS
20230264881 · 2023-08-24 ·

A multiple-panel system present in a chamber of a reed container secures and orders one or more woodwind reeds in a base to tip arrangement. The chamber has a length and width dimension to hold one or more woodwind reeds. The multiple panel system includes a cover and at least two parallel panels with aligned openings that position individual reed. One opening is shaped to accommodate the reed base and the other opening is U-shaped to receive the midsection of reed, when the reed is introduced trough the container opening. The width of U-shaped opening impedes lateral movement of the aligned reed through contact with the midsection of the reed. This contact avoids reed tip contact with a wall during transport.
